- Purification
-
Delipidated, heat inactivated, lyophilized, stable whole antiserum
Immunoaffinity adsorbed using insolubilized antigens as required to eliminate antibodies cross-reacting with other components of the immunoglobulin system or reacting with other serum proteins. Special attention is given to the removal of antibodies to common Ig/Fab. The use of insolubilized adsorption antigens prevents the presence of excess adsorbent protein or immune complexes in the antiserum. Hyperimmune antisera with strong precipitating activity are selected for fractionation and purification of the IgG (7S) fraction containing the bulk of the defined antibody specificity. It is free of other serum proteins as tested by immunoelectrophoresis. - Immunogen
- Pools of purified homogenous IgG2b isolated from mouse serum. Freund's complete adjuvant is used in the first step of the immunization procedure.

- Application Notes
- In immunoelectrophoresis use 2 µL or equivalent against 120 µL antiserum. In double radial immunodiffusion (Ouchterlony) use a rosette arrangement with 10 µL antiserum in a 3 mm diameter centre well and 2 µL serum samples (neat and diluted) in 2 mm diameter peripheral wells.

- Handling Advice
- Dilutions may be prepared by adding phosphate buffered saline (PBS, pH 7. 2). Repeated thawing and freezing should be avoided. If a slight precipitation occurs upon storage, this should be removed by centrifugation. It will not affect the performance of the antiserum. Diluted antiserum should be stored at +4 °C, not ref rozen, and preferably used the same day.
